What are the responsibilities and job description for the Receptionist Weekends position at Bonney-Watson?

 

Summary:

Provides receptionist assistance for mortuary and/or cemetery activities and assistance to facility visitors by performing the following duties.

Essential Duties and Responsibilities include the following. Other duties may be assigned.

• Answers incoming telephone calls, determines purpose of callers, and forwards calls to appropriate personnel or department.

• Takes and delivers messages or transfers calls to voice mail when appropriate personnel are unavailable.

• Answers questions about organization and provides callers with address, directions, and other information.

• Welcomes on-site visitors, determines nature of business, and announces visitors to appropriate personnel. Escorts visitors to the staterooms, chapel area or other areas of the facility as needed. Maintains an awareness of the whereabouts of visitors.

• Receives, sorts, and routes mail, and maintains and routes publications.

• Creates and prints fax cover sheets, memos, correspondence, reports, and other documents when necessary.

• Performs other clerical duties as needed, such as filing, photocopying, and collating. Updates and distributes the daily schedule. (Weekend positions only; not evening positions.)

• Accepts/processes payments on accounts and payments received during daily arrangements from clients and issues receipts.

• Communicates the requests of visitors to funeral directors, family service staff, or other appropriate staff members.

• Facilitates effective coordination of the arrangement offices. Collects personal effects delivered by client families; completes the personal effects form and routes to the funeral director.

• Serves as an assistant to the Manager with secretarial tasks, including but not limited to typing correspondence and distributing documents.

• Reviews, balances, and interprets computer reports, and makes corrections.
